The 28BYJ-48 Stepper Motor is a compact and cost-effective stepper motor widely used in DIY electronics, robotics, and automation projects. Known for its high precision and low power consumption, this motor is an ideal choice for applications requiring accurate position control. With its 4-phase, 5-wire design, the 28BYJ-48 can be easily controlled using motor driver modules like ULN2003. It operates at low voltage (5V or 12V depending on the variant) and provides reliable torque for small-scale mechanical movements.

Product Specifications

Specification Details
Motor Type Unipolar Stepper Motor
Voltage Rating 5V DC or 12V DC (depending on variant)
Step Angle 5.625°/64
Gear Reduction Ratio 1/64
Phases 4-phase, 5-wire motor
Coil Resistance ~50Ω (for 5V version)
Rated Current ~240 mA
Diameter 28 mm
Shaft Type Single shaft with flattened edge
Connector 5-pin header for ULN2003 driver board

Frequently Asked Questions

You can connect the motor to an ULN2003 driver board and then interface the board with Arduino digital pins for step sequence control.

This motor is available in 5V and 12V versions. The most common variant is 5V, which is widely used with Arduino and Raspberry Pi.

It is not recommended to drive the motor directly. The ULN2003 driver board or equivalent should be used for proper current handling and control.

No, the 28BYJ-48 is a small stepper motor designed for lightweight and low-torque applications. For higher loads, consider using NEMA stepper motors.
